<p>A fibroepithelial polyp is a medical expression which is used to name these epidermal bumps. These can grow any where on the skin. The most common places for these to occur are under the breast area, on the eyelids, the top part of the chest, the armpits, neck, and groin range. You will know these because they tend to be soft, are painless (unless irritated), and pendulous.</p>
<p>Humans who weigh too much, and those who are morbidly obese are the most prone to these dilemmas. Let us understand, because there are more skin folds, to scrape against themselves, there is the tendency to have these epidermal extensions. Women who are carrying babies inside them, with larger hormonal flow, can become victims to this affliction.</p>
<p>Individuals who have experimented with illegal use of steroids are also at higher risk than the general populace. Steroids interfere with muscles, causing collagen filaments to glue to each other, forming these skin lesions. Those who have the Human Papilloma virus, or diabetes, are also more likely to obtain these situations. If you fall into any of these groups you may want to take preventative measures.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As a chiropractor in San Diego, I deal with many patients who are overweight. New research suggests being obese may spread through social networks like a malicious virus. And more importantly, your friends can even live hundreds of miles away! The surrender slogan for many overweight and obese individuals for years has been I can't help it - it's in my genes. And who could blame these overweight individuals? Even many doctors and researchers believed your ability to lose weight or pack on pounds was primarily a function of your genetic make-up.</p>
<p>If you were dealt a bad genetic hand, your fate was to be overweight. Now, new information shows that might not be the case all the time. The first is a study published in the New England Journal of Medicine which found that the obesity epidemic could spread like a virus through social networks. When a person becomes obese or overweight, his friends and siblings are likely to gain weight as well.</p>
<p>The researchers evaluated a network of over twelve thousand people who underwent repeated measurements over a period of over thirty years. They found that when a person becomes obese, the chances that a friend will become obese increase by about fifty seven percent. Siblings of obese people have a forty percent increased risk of obesity, and their spouse's risk increased by thirty seven percent overall.</p>
<p>On average, having an obese friend made a person gain 17 pounds, which put many people over the body mass index (BMI) measure for obesity. Female friendships did not seem to be impacted by obesity. But the chances that a man might gain weight from having a fat pal doubled for so-called mutual friends -- friends who both listed each other as buddies.</p>
<p>"There is an important implication here for a broadening perspective on treatment for obesity, said Dr. Nicholas Christakis, the study's lead author. We don't think that this is the only cause of obesity. This is adding one additional factor or explanation. Attitudes are changing about what constitutes an acceptable body size, more so than a sharing of behaviors.</p>
<p>One big question raised by the study was why didn't having obese friends affect the women's weight like it did the men's weight. There is a strong social bias for women towards being thin," said Dr. Robert Kushner, President of the American Board of Nutrition Physician Specialists. "Social norms may trump social networks here. Guys don't have the same social pressure as women do. Men may be more influenced by their friends than women.</p>
<p>Other diet experts agree that the inner workings of male friendships may have a lot to do with obesity. "Current social stigma against obesity is greater among women than men. Women jointly discuss weight and support each other in dieting and exercising," said Jeffery Sobal, a Professor of Nutritional Science at Cornell University. "Men may engage in joint activities that increase weight, such as consuming more calories or spending time in sedentary activities."</p>
<p>And here's something else that is interesting reported by researcher James Fowler of Harvard University and Nicholas Christakis of the University of California in San Diego. They stated that it is plausible that "areas of the brain that correspond to actions such as eating food may be stimulated if these actions are observed by others." This can cause you to become overweight.</p>
<p>Social ties seem to play a surprisingly strong role, even more than genes are known to do. Obesity, they state, is "socially contagious" and, remarkably, the researchers found that to be true even if your loved ones live far away. "We were stunned to find that friends who are hundreds of miles away have just as much impact on a person's weight status as friends who are right next door," said Dr Fowler.</p>
<p>Despite their findings, the researchers said people should not sever their relationships. "There is a ton of research that suggests that having more friends makes you healthier," Fowler said. "So the last thing that you want to do is get rid of any of your friends." Clearly, this study shows the importance of behavior in weight gain overshadowing genetic make-up. 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Oh the mysterious Frankincense -- it really holds a special status in the world of natural medicine. What other plant extract has been valued as highly as gold, sought after by kings, and been one of the world's most recognized birthday presents? There must be something to it too, as university's around the world have found it important enough to spend significant sums investigating its medicinal effects. What follows is a summary of the great benefits of this nearly magical oil, and how you can make use of it.</p>
<p>The Olibanum tree from which Frankincense is extracted, is upon first glance may seem rather unremarkable. It appears as a giant shrub, with many knurled branches topped with abundant slender leaves and occasionally, small white flowers. A native to northern Africa, it even looks like it belongs in the desert, growing in some of the world's harshest conditions. When the tree's bark is pierced with a 'mingaf' knife, a milky-white resin is exuded and collected; thought the tree is not harmed. The resin forms droplets known as tears or pearls, which harden in to the orange-brown gum known itself as Frankincense.</p>
<p>Modern natural medicine and aromatherapy have taken to the use of the essential oil of Frankincense. The oil, having a warm, woody, sweet aroma with a hint of citrus, is steam or CO2 distilled from the resin. There are several species of Olibanum tree from which the resin is collected and the essential oil distilled, the most popular being Boswellia "carteri" and Boswellia "seratta". Carteri has been the most widely researched for medical applications, and seratta is appreciated for its rich, exotic aroma. The new modern CO2 distillations are more likely to contain the same healthful compounds as the historically-used resin. One of America's leading medical aromatherapist notes, regarding the production of essential oil from the resin, "It could be that the (health-related) substances in question are too polar and too large a molecular size to appear in steam distillates - their presence would be more likely in CO2 extracts."</p>
<p>The very wide range of therapeutic applications is one of the most appealing features of Frankincense. First off, it is highly revered for its use in skin care, particularly for mature skin that may be prematurely aging due so sun exposure. The desert-source of the plant material makes this use almost obvious. Extracts of the resin have even been the subject of double-blind studies, where one have of each participant's face received the preparation with the "active ingredient". The result was a significant improvement in skin texture (a measurable decrease in roughness), as well as a reduction in the appearance of fine lines. To benefit from the oil this way, you could add 4 to 12 drops per ounce to a cream or lotion you're already using, or if making up a new formula, use the essential oil at a concentration between .5% and 2%.</p>
<p>Boswellia extracts (like the CO2 distillation) have found their way into many common over-the-counter pain relieving and anti-inflammatory preparations for joint and muscular pain. Natural chemicals in the oils inhibit the action of pro-inflammatory enzymes. Frankincense essential oil in combination with other anti-inflammatory and analgesic oils can be of great support for arthritis, fibromyalgia, and other painful conditions. A blend to consider for these needs: in each ounce of carrier oil (sweet almond is fine), add 40 drops Frankincense, 40 drops Ginger CO2, 40 drops Sweet Marjoram and 40 drops Plai. Not only is the pain likely to be significantly reduced, but you're knees will smell wonderful as well!</p>
<p>Perhaps the most impressive therapeutic potential of Frankincense lay in its now extensively researched anti-cancer activity. The resin and its extracts have been shown to specifically target cancer cells in a number of different organs, causing apoptosis (normal cell death, which doesn't "normally" occur in cancer cells) to the cancerous cells, leaving healthy ones unaffected. While treatment protocols are still a ways off, it is possible to include daily doses of Frankincense as a protective measure. The essential oil is rapidly absorbed through the skin and into the bloodstream -- small doses can also reasonably be ingested with the guide of a natural health professional.</p>
<p>In terms of "aroma" therapy, Frankincense can be an excellent antidepressant and grounding aromatic. A diffuser or warming lamp can be used to disperse the aroma throughout your environment. Frankincense oil can be applied directly to the forehead where you can both capture the aroma and absorb the oil directly (it is non-irritating or sensitizing, though if you do experience sensitivity, simply dilute to 5-10% in a carrier oil). It is considered deeply calming, and has been noted to have the potential to actually slow the breathing rate -- a very interesting effect, considering that some physicians believe our life spans to be governed by the number of breaths we take, and not the number of heartbeats. Our breathing patterns are also directly related to our stress level: under stress, we tend to take shallow, rapid breaths, and while relaxed, breathing is slower and deeper.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Acne is the most common skin problem that usually begins at the age of puberty. The main cause of acne is the clogged of skin's pore. Dead skin cells and excessive oil production are the most important factors that clogged the skin's pores. Pimples, whiteheads and blackhead are the different variations of acne.</p>
<p>Acne is commonly found in our face. This makes acne not only a physical condition but sometimes an emotional and/or psychological one. But acne symptoms may appear on the neck, chest, and shoulders or at the back. Acne is prevalent among teens and young adults; however, children can also be affected with acne.</p>
<p>Nowadays you can find thousands over the counter acne care products easily. You also can consult to the dermatologist in order to get prompt treatment for your acne. But you have to realize that there several things that you have to do for treating your acne and prevent the acne formation. Here are some tips for solving your acne problem.</p>
<p>We all know that the clogged of skin ores is the main cause of acne. So eradicating the dirt, dead skin cells and excessive oil production is very important in acne free treatment. We can do this by washing the face twice a day using a mild soap and lukewarm water. Avoid scrub products or washing the skin too often. Use a smooth towel to pad your skin dry.</p>
<p>Almost all of us have a tendency to touch the area where the problem is. We also act the same pattern whenever suffer from acne disorder. Some people even believe that squeezing the pimples or acne will help to remove from the face. But in fact this habit will only make the acne condition worsen. It can cause severe acne scarring and more acne flare-ups.</p>
<p>Applying oil-based cosmetics or skin care products have to be avoided because they can clog your skin pores more badly than your own oil production. Always choose water-based cosmetics or skin care products if you suffer from acne disorder. Please recognize the type of your skin and then make sure the products are made for your skin type.</p>
<p>If you want to get acne free please take enough rest by sleeping about 6-8 hours a day. Sleeping well so important to make the body keeps their function in good condition include your skin condition. Take care about the stress factor. Managing the stress plays crucial rule in acne free program especially in adult people. Following a healthy diet plan and drinking about 10-12 glasses a day will help you achieving the dream of acne free.</p>
<p>In men, shaving can cause irritation on skin or spreading acne. Remember to use a sharp and safety while shaving. Before shaving, please washing the face and neck with mild soap and warm water and then apply a shaving cream. Avoid using shaving cream which has menthol in the ingredient list because menthol may irritate your acne.</p>
<p>Most severe acne cases and acne scar can not treat by ordinary acne treatment. The patients should consider getting special acne treatment from professional dermatologist. They can select a good clinic that offer comprehensive acne care including medicines, acne diet plan, skin care facility, and modern acne treatment such as laser or blue light procedures.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><b>Historical and Current Uses</b></p>
<p>Sandalwood is one of the oldest aromatic materials, being acknowledged in ancient biblical and in Indian text as well as used in religious ceremonies throughout the ages. Botanically known as a small evergreen in the genus Santalum and family Santalaceae, this modest-sized tree (up to 10 meters) provides a great deal of commerce for India and to some extent Australia and is now being examined by the medical industry for its medicinal properties. There are several species of Santalum, but only a few are used commercially, most notably Santalum album (India) and Santalum spicatum (Australia). Other tress from such places as Polynesia and Fuji are in small numbers and in great decline. Oddly, other plants such as the Bead Tree or Candlewood are known as sandalwood but are not botanically parallel. Sometimes, non-related plants such as Red Sandalwood are used as fillers for the more expensive, genuine sandalwood.</p>
<p>True sandalwood contains aromatic heartwood (middle) and roots which when harvested are used for furniture items as well as distilled for its highly prized essential oil. Plantations have been set aside in both India and Australia to meet growing demand for Santalum essential oil. Sandalwood harvesting and manufacturing of incense sticks, furniture and essential oil provides great employment for many in India, especially in southern India. The value of sandalwood in India cannot be overstated. Besides its ceremonial significance, sandalwood is used extensively in Indian Ayurvedic medicine. The harvest and processing of sandalwood is strictly regulated and private ownership of the trees is not permitted. Since 1792 trees have been considered of Indian royalty and thus well guarded and protected. These valued trees take decades to develop their rich aromatic wood and are not considered commercially viable until at least forty years of age, but trees have been harvested at thirty to meet rising requests for its processed products.</p>
<p>Much of the valuable wood is found in the roots of sandalwood and thus harvested by uprooting the entire tree versus cutting it at the trunk. In the last few years alone, the price of sandalwood has skyrocketed, mainly due to rising demand and limited supply. Increased demand has mainly come from the perfume and aromatherapy industry. Sandalwood essential oil and paste is used in Indian and Chinese medicine and of course aromatherapy botanical medicine. The perfume industry covets this oil for its ability to blend well with other perfume oils; hence, it is used extensively in hundreds of cosmetic products.</p>
<p>Over the centuries, the use of sandalwood and its products have been an integral part of several religious cultures. It scent, either as an essential oil or ground as incense, is thought to bring one closer to the Divine. Hindus burn incense made from sandalwood oil in burial pyres and at funerals. It's also used in temples to remind people of the heavenly realms. Yogis in India use the oil to anoint each other during ceremonies and before meditation as well deity statues often made of sandalwood itself.</p>
<p><b>Sandalwood May Help with Antibiotic Resistance</b></p>
<p>Opposition to antibiotic use in food agriculture has been gaining momentum. In years past, it was known that severe illness-causing microbes such as Salmonella and E. coli could be contracted through eating contaminated meat. Now, it is proposed that contraction of bacteria, in this case antibiotic resistant bacteria, can possibly be transferred through ingestion, handling of industrial animal manure, as well as through drinking manure-contaminated ground water. With these scenarios coming to the surface, scientists and government officials alike are in alarm and strongly suggesting the decrease if not absolute elimination of non-therapeutic uses of antibiotics in the meat industry. Recent media has brought attention to the proposed link between the steep increase of antibiotic-resistant microbes with use and perhaps misuse of antibiotics in agriculture. Modern industrial agriculture raises animals in tight often inhumane quarters which results in animals being much more susceptible to sickness and disease, thus the administration of antibiotics is very common. Because bacteria and other microbes can easily mutate (in as little as 20 minutes), it is no wonder that great concern is now mounting.</p>
<p>Concern for antibiotic-resistant microbes is worldwide. A need to find alternatives to conventional antibiotic treatment is rising. Essential oils have been gaining attention by research scientists for their antimicrobial properties. A collaborative study of researchers in Austria and Germany (Flavor and Fragrance Journal 2006 May/Jun; 21(3): 465-468) found that santalols of sandalwood (the main chemical components of sandalwood) in medium and/or high concentrations showed significant antimicrobial potential against the yeast Candida albicans, the Gram-positive bacterium Staphylococcus aureus, and the Gram-negative bacteria Escherichia coli,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Klebsiella pneumoniae.</p>
<p><b>Other Promising Uses</b></p>
<p>The Australian and Indian Santalum species, found to be similar in chemical composition, are known by aromatherapists to have such therapeutic properties as anti-inflammatory, antiphlogistic (reduces fever), antiseptic (as mentioned above), antispasmodic (relieves muscle spasms), astringent, carminative (relieves flatulence), demulcent (reduces irritation), diuretic (soft and soothing to skin), emollient, expectorant, as a sedative and general tonic. Their principle chemical constituents are alpha-santalol and beta-santalol. According to a study conducted by the Department of Pharmaceutical Sciences and South Dakota University (Anticancer Research 2007 Jul-Aug; 27(4B): 2185-8) application of the chemical compound alpha-santalol prevents UVB-induced skin tumor development in mice. Sandalwood is also thought to help alleviate the symptoms of depression as reported by the University of Maryland Medical Center (www.umm.edu).</p>
<p><b>Summing It Up</b></p>
<p>It is rather evident that the value of sandalwood extends across centuries and continents. It is revered by various religions, scientists, aromatherapists and perfume enthusiasts alike. What is remarkable is that uses of plants and their essential oils are bringing such world-wide engagement as their promising applications are uncovered in scientific research. A need for alternatives to conventional antibiotics as well as insecticides is clear. As less-than amiable agriculture practices surface and resistance to current antimicrobials increase, it is apparent that humankind will revert back to solutions found in nature and perhaps make a more diligent effort to conserve the very earth that sustains us.</p>

<p>Alzheimer's and dementia are frequently linked together, since Alzheimer's is the encompassing problem of lost memory, along with other indicators including depression or lack of attention, and on the other hand dementia is the general deterioration of someone's mind. In the beginning of Alzheimer's, you will note that someone will start to forget people's names or frequently used words that are used during normal conversation. When this happens once or twice, you shouldn't worry. But, if you note that your loved one is creating a made-up word to take the place of a word that's slipped their mind, or if they're becoming more and more withdrawn in order to avoid 'messing up' during conversation, you may be witness to the first signs of Alzheimer's and dementia.</p>
<p>A lack of interest to do some things, or sometimes personality changes can be a sign of Alzheimer's and dementia. If someone has dementia, completing normal tasks can be a challenge. This means chores like eating lunch, tying laces, and getting dressed in the morning may be completed less frequently as the condition gets worse. The brain slows down, and neurotransmitters do not do their job as often. If you find that your parent or grandparent has started to put things in strange places around the home, such as putting a check book in between sofa cushions, or find a toothbrush in the dishwasher, this could be a sign that it's time to meet with the doctor.</p>
<p>During the more progressed stages of Alzheimer's and dementia, you'll see that it's difficult for your loved one to organize their thought processes, and it could be more difficult for your mom to recognize their family. Once you talk with your doctor, you can work out a treatment plan for your loved one to help to meet their needs. Typically that most patients last for approximately 10 years after the original diagnosis, but some even live twenty years after the disease has been detected.</p>

<p>Some people are under the mistaken assumption that the only time to use sunscreen is on especially hot and sunny days. The truth is that anytime that were out in the sun, the suns rays are having a negative impact on our skin. There is a constant barrage of ultraviolet light that can cause our skin to age before its time, and it can lead to more serious skin problems in the long term. Even on days when its not all that hot outside, it is a good idea to use sunscreen.</p>
<p>With that said, sunscreen is still most needed when a person is spending a day out in the sun, especially if theyre trying to tan. This is when there is the biggest risk of sunburn, which is a direct result of intense sun exposure. Its important to understand how to choose the right sunscreen for the job. SPF, or sun protection factor, is the rating system that is used to determine the strength of a sunscreen. Usually, a minimum sun protection factor of 15 is recommended for tanning or prolonged sun exposure. However, much more powerful levels of protection are available -- up to a 60 SPF rating or more.</p>
<p>There is another factor to consider, as well. There are multiple types of ultraviolet light rays that are harmful to the skin -- UVA and UVB. Many sunscreens are designed to effectively block only one UVB rays, while UVA are actually the more dangerous type. It is a good idea to look for a sunscreen that is designed to block both types of rays. Sunscreens that contain the ingredients zinc oxide, ecamsule, or avobenzone are the best choices for full-spectrum protection.</p>
<p>When it comes to just routine daily sun exposure, a full application of sunscreen isnt really necessary. If youre just eating lunch outdoors or walking for a little while outside, then you should be okay just using other skin-care products that contain minor sunscreens. For example, there are many facial moisturizers that include enough sunscreen to protect your skin from the suns rays on a day-to-day basis.</p>
<p>One of the negative effects associated with sun exposure to the skin is wrinkling. The sun is one of the primary factors when it comes to skin starting to look aged before its time. For people who are concerned about aging and wrinkled skin, there are special sunscreen treatments that are design both to reduce and prevent wrinkles. Many of these have high SPF ratings for maximum protection from the suns light.</p>
<p>Aside from wrinkles, the other major impact of the sun on human skin is skin cancer. Heavy exposure to the sun without the proper protection can lead to a person developing deadly skin cancers. <p>Since acne being such a common problem, there is a huge market available for acne skin care products. Many of these are effective while others are just plain hoaxes. Whatever which acne skin care product you choose, expecting instant results can be very unrealistic. </p>
<p>The most effective products take at least a couple of weeks before they begin to work noticeably. If the acne skin care product contains appropriate ingredients, the acne will recede in three months or so. In other words one should not reply on advertising that promises overnight results. </p>
<p>Adult acne is a moderately serious form of skin inflammation. The affected pilosebaceous units in the skin will need to undergo the required modifications before it can reduce. Sometimes one type of acne skin care product may not get the desired effect. </p>
<p>In such cases, your dermatologist may prescribe a combination of products for use in tandem. The aim of acne treatment is to normalize shedding into the pore to prevent blockage and kill the bacteria that cause the problem. Moreover the acne product used must provide anti-inflammatory relief to the skin and manipulate the patient's hormonal balance in the skin.</p>
<p>Acne skin care products can trigger severe allergic reactions in patients who are sensitized to their ingredients. These ingredients can have some rather unpleasant side effects and one must weight the advantages of using such products against their potential drawbacks. Patients must not use acne skin care products which containing such active ingredients without medical supervision. They can have unsafe interactions with existing medications and may even make the acne worse. A dermatologist must analyze the patient's problem before he can prescribe the suitable acne skin care product.</p>
<p>One of the most radical products used in acne treatment are exfoliating agents which slough off a thin layer of the affected skin. They invariably contain strong chemicals such as salicylic acid and glycolic acid. These chemicals peel off the superficial skin layer, thereby removing dead skin cells that block the underlying pores. </p>
<p>They also have an unclogging effect on pores which are already blocked. Many compounds in this genre of acne skin care products are available over-the-counter, meaning that no doctor's prescription is needed to buy them. These products normally contain moisturizing agents to offset the exfoliating compound's dehydrating effects.</p>
